Who are CHAS Central London and What Do They Do?


Chas Central London Became An Independent Charity On The 1st April 2003.
Chas Cl Provides Free And Independent Housing And Debt Advice Covering Geographically All Of London, Surrey, Middlesex, Hampshire, Kent, East & West Sussex, Hertfordshire, Berkshire, Essex ,Bedfordshire & Devon
Chas Cl Has A Legal Services Commission Contract In Housing & Debt And Is Contracted To Provide Advice And Assistance To Tenants And Lessees Of Other Local Authorities And Of Housing Associations
Chas Is An Acronym For The “Catholic Housing Aid Society” Which Was Formed In 1959 And Was One Of The Founders Of Shelter And The Family Housing Association
CHAS CL works to prevent homelessness, both by helping people who are homeless or badly housed, and by assisting the campaign to tackle the root causes of homelessness.
CHAS CL is a member of the Housing Justice Alliance of Advice Agencies. Housing Justice’s Policy and Education Team combines expertise in both housing policy and adult education to raise people’s awareness of housing and homelessness and equip them to tackle the long term causes of homelessness.
